About this home

Exceptional 10-unit investment property in South Etobicoke. Completely renovated in 2018, featuring new wiring, plumbing, and modern kitchens with quartz counters and stainless steel appliances. Each unit includes in-suite laundry and A/C. The basement's height is 7.6 feet, and a security system with 6 cameras provides peace of mind. A 2020 roof and 6 parking spaces complete this impressive offering. The total square footage, as per floor plans, measures an impressive 6,648 square feet. The property's location adds to its appeal, with its proximity to the waterfront, walking/cycling trails, schools, Humber College's Lakeshore Campus, and public transit (including GO Train access). The existing mortgage is available for takeover at a rate of 3.30% with a maturity date at the end of 2028.

Mortgage stress test

6.14%Qualifying rate
$23,308/monthPayment at the qualifying rate

Lenders qualify you at the greater of your rate plus 2% or 5.25%. You do not pay this rate. It just shows you could still handle payments if rates rose, so aim to stay comfortable at this higher number.
